    Abstract: A system and method are provided for quantifying a degree of discontinuity of material flow from a meter roller. In an exemplary embodiment, flowable particulate material is fed into a meter roller. The meter roller is then rotated one revolution, and the output from the meter roller is collected and measured. Next, the meter roller is rotated one revolution in discrete increments, each increment having a substantially equal rotational angle. The output from the meter roller is then collected and measured for each increment. Finally, the measurement for each increment is compared to the measurement for the one revolution to determine a statistical parameter indicative of flow rate discontinuity.

    Abstract: A femoral component of a hip implant is disclosed. The femoral component may be used specifically in a neck sparing resection (i.e., any process or device that avoids removing the femoral neck) and may include a shortened stem (with respect to a conventional stem) having a terminal flare portion for internally contacting a medial calcar portion of the proximal femur, and a significant curvature on its medial side. Other features of the femoral component include, flat side portions on the anterior and posterior sides of the stem, a lateral fin or a wing or T-back to aid in resisting torsional forces. The femoral component may also include a sagittal slot for proper fitting and placement in the femoral canal. The femoral component may also include a neck component that is modular with respect to the stem component. A head component, whether monoblock or modular with respect to the neck component, may also be utilized as part of the femoral component.
